You need a work permit A francophone community immigration pilot applicant needs a work permit

If you applied to the Francophone Community Immigration Pilot (FCIP), you need a work permit to work in Canada.

Based on your answer, you may be eligible for a 2-year employer-specific work permit. You must also meet the general eligibility requirements for a work permit.

Work permits for spouses or common-law partners

Your spouse or common-law partner can apply for an open work permit at the same time as you apply for your 2-year work permit.

Their work permit will only let them work in the same community as you.
